Start Small
Start small with a habit, like you're whispering a secret to yourself that you don't even want to wind to pick up on, lest a small breeze carry it to the dark side of your heart where you will once again hear the endless tirade, listing your failed attempts of all the years. Start small with a habit. Embrace the five minutes while the tea steeps, where it can be hardly noticed and wholly purposeful. Start small, even while the dishes calling from the sink and the blankets sit askew. Even while the counter shines with sticky and the scissors are left not put away. Start small with a habit leave it small if you must. Let it begin to feel like stolen time, precious time, time taken for you, by you, unnoticeable in its effort on the day. Start small, until a ripple begins to stir the chambers of your heart, and creates an opening, an understanding that if left small enough, noncommittal enough, this small habit will render everything else that used to fill that sliver of time useless. And then, only then, will it unwind the time, breeze past the insufficiencies of your discipline and perhaps, just perhaps, change your whole life. Start small.
